Output de580dd8ca612bba1443061c99847c844f62c401b404d9888c95389cf6736d4b:5

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70502c20d9a545dd4a7b46a75d3c83171c11fae3 OP_EQUAL
address
3BvseW8kPWxv9o7iYVQ6QCEuAV1cFky5pC
transaction
de580dd8ca612bba1443061c99847c844f62c401b404d9888c95389cf6736d4b
spent
true